
Properties in Egypt: Your Comprehensive Guide to Buying Real Estate
Egypt, a land of ancient wonders and modern developments, offers a broad spectrum of properties that attract buyers from across the globe. Whether you are seeking a vacation home, the country presents various property types including luxurious beachfront villas, city apartments, and traditional houses. Thanks to rapid development, legislative incentives, and increasing foreign interest, Egypt is fast becoming one of the most attractive real estate markets in the Middle East.
One of the most compelling reasons to invest in properties in Egypt is the combination of affordability and high potential returns. Unlike many other countries where real estate prices have skyrocketed, Egypt presents affordable options in cities like Cairo, Alexandria, and along the Red Sea coast. This makes it accessible for a wide range of buyers, from individuals purchasing second homes to investors expanding their portfolios. Moreover, Egypt’s real estate market is supported by initiatives to attract foreign buyers, such as residency programs and streamlined property laws, which encourage international investment.

Important Tips for Buyers
Legal and Ownership Regulations
Understanding the legal framework is essential when buying property. It is advisable to consult experienced lawyers and agents to verify title deeds, check for liens, and complete registration properly.
Impact of Location on Value
Where you buy plays a major role in property appreciation and rental demand. Major cities and new developments offer easy access to transport, education, and healthcare. Coastal properties provide luxury lifestyle and rental advantages.
